Output 0baff32f4eef7dc5cfdfea3a3e413bf2bf20544cd13e882514cfc76d2d29db3f:0

value
17212670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fd0ff5855326fe6a3493c60e1090b057ea3be3 OP_EQUAL
address
395F8yCm4CLwErokstMaxBnthejaHXnTcM
transaction
0baff32f4eef7dc5cfdfea3a3e413bf2bf20544cd13e882514cfc76d2d29db3f
confirmations
274141
spent
true